Kepro is certified by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) to serve as an independent dispute resolution entity (IDRE), or third-party arbiter, in the IDR process established by the No Surprises Act (NSA). The Act created new federal safeguards as of January 2022 against surprise medical bills that arise when consumers inadvertently receive care from out-of-network hospitals, doctors, or other providers they did not choose. When a provider or facility and a health plan can’t agree on the payment amount for an out-of-network service experienced by a patient, they are now able to initiate the new federal independent dispute resolution process using an approved arbiter like Kepro.
